BBC Furious After Ron Dennis Prank
Posted by Mark on July 13, 2010 | No Comments
It has been reported that Ron Dennis has angered the BBC after he cut the wires to Eddie Jordan’s custom made earpieces during the post race show at Silverstone. This meant he couldn’t hear the production crew properly and when a standard set of earpieces was hurriedly supplied, they kept falling out.
Dennis appeared in the background behind Eddie Jordan during a post race interview with Christian Horner, but then quickly disappeared with a big grin on his face. As Jordan began to interview Horner he realised that he had no sound to his earpieces, and when a BBC technician inspected the equipment he found that the wires from the control box to his earpieces had been cut.
The BBC are not amused that equipment paid for by the public has been damaged by Dennis, it will be interesting to see if any further action is taken…..
